Step 1: Playthrough the Story By simply progressing through the story, you'll unlock 8 of the 12 achievements worth a total of 160http://www.xbox360achievements.org/images/misc/g-icon.gif. Not bad right? Step 2: Grinding and Buying View my Blingbot guide to see how to get credits easiest. When you get your 'Blingbot' achievement, go to the main computer and purchase all concept art and action part upgrades and overall you'll be 30http://www.xbox360achievements.org/images/misc/g-icon.gif richer, leaving just 10http://www.xbox360achievements.org/images/misc/g-icon.gif to go. Step 3: Ship Parts Go through each level and find all individual ship parts. There will be a guide up soon. There are 100 in total, and when you pick up the hundredth, you'll get your last achievement and you'll have completed the game. Note that some are only obtainable in co-op, so a second controller or friend will suffice. Spare Parts is available for purchase on Xbox LIVE for 800 Microsoft Points. On an overall note, the game is pretty easy to 200G, most of the achievements are story related or really easy. If you miss these, then... wait, you can't be that stupid. http://i288.photobucket.com/albums/ll183/DarklordZerato/-AtNXA.jpgShop-o-bot - 10http://www.xbox360achievements.org/images/misc/g-icon.gif Present for the purchase of all unlockable concept art After completing the first few stages, you can visit the hub and access the main computer and purchase all concept art. There aren't that many. All of the concept art together costs 19,500 credits. http://i288.photobucket.com/albums/ll183/DarklordZerato/-ipE6Q.jpgBetter, Faster, Stronger - 10http://www.xbox360achievements.org/images/misc/g-icon.gif Present at the purchase of all Action Part upgrades These will cost X credits and should be achieved near the end of the game. MysticWeirdo Posted January 21, 2011 Share Posted January 21, 2011 Does anyone know if you definitely need to get some of the parts during co-op? And is there local co-op in this game, or does it have to be someone else over Live? Both. Local coop is drop in so you can sign in a second controller to help you get a ship part then drop out so you can continue in single player.
